KWSG to increase incentives for teachers
The Permanent Secretary, Kwara State Ministry of Education, Alhaji Lamidi Alabi, made the announcement on Wednesday in Ilorin in an interview with the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N).
Alabi said the measure would act as a check on the movement of teachers from the state.
He explained that the incentives would entail giving loans to teachers in various capacities and giving them training opportunities.
The permanent secretary said that government had already commissioned the Kwara Resource Centre to train and produce the right calibre of teachers for the state.
Alabi said that 500 teachers had already received training in the centre, adding that the capacity acquired would enable them to teach effectively.
